Safety Feature Underneath Trucks Is Inadequate, Report Concludes | Shapiro, Washburn & Sharp

They are supposed to be safety features to help safeguard drivers who are involved in accidents with tractor trailers.

But new crash tests and analysis by the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ety demonstrate that underride guards on tractor-trailers can fail in relatively low-speed crashes, with deadly consequences.
